Original Description
The painting Sainte Marie-Madeleine et Deux Anges by Pietro Faccini (1562–1602) is a striking example of late Mannerist religious art, radiating both piety and emotional intensity. Set against a dramatic, shadowy background, the repentant Mary Magdalene is flanked by two angels, their ethereal forms creating a celestial counterbalance to her earthly sorrow. Faccini’s composition—marked by elongated figures, dynamic poses, and rich chiaroscuro—reflects the influence of his mentor, the Carracci family, yet retains a distinctive theatricality characteristic of late Renaissance Bologna. Though less renowned than his contemporaries, Faccini’s work is celebrated for its expressive depth and mastery of light, bridging the transition from Mannerism to the emerging Baroque style. This piece stands as a testament to Counter-Reformation spirituality, where human emotion and divine grace intertwine.
